GOODLETTSVILLE, Tenn. (WSMV) - The U.S. Marshals Service Middle Tennessee Fugitive Task Force arrested a man wanted on sex offender registration violation charges in Goodlettsville, Wednesday morning.
A warrant for the arrest of Johnthony Kenton Walker, 33, was issued on August 21, charging him with two counts of sex offender registration violation.

USMS said detectives with the Metro Nashville Police Department Special Victims and Sex Offender Unit reached out to them to launch an investigation into Walker’s whereabouts.
Marshals located Walker at an apartment on North Main Street in Goodlettsville on Wednesday morning. He was arrested and booked into the Davidson County Jail on his outstanding warrants.
